TINUBU SET TO COMMISSION NIGERIA POLICE NATIONAL CYBERCRIME CENTRE WEDNESDAY
The recently constructed Nigeria Police National Cybercrime Centre in Abuja will be officially opened by President Bola Tinubu.
According to a statement sent by X on Tuesday and signed by ACP Olumuyiwa Adejobi, the Force Public Relations Officer, the facility would be put into use on Wednesday.
